    What does a Foot Surgeon do?

    A foot surgeon, typically a podiatrist or orthopedic surgeon, has expertise in diagnosing and treating conditions affecting the foot and ankle. They use both surgical and non-surgical treatments for issues such as fractures, deformities, and chronic pain, aiming to restore function and improve overall foot health.
